Lincoln (UK) June 2009 Latitude 53° 13'49.80N June Valid 1st- 30th June, 2009 Highest Temperature: 27.8°C/82f (30th) Lowest Temperature: 4.7C/40.5f (4th) Mean Maximum: 19.5c/67.1f Mean Minimum: 10.2c/50.4f Mean Temperature: 14.8c/58.6f --------------------- Lowest Maximum: 13.6c/56.5f (4th) Highest Minimum: 15.2c/59.4f (28th) --------------------- Precipitation: 37.2mm/1.46"* Days with rain >1mm: 3 Days with rain: 10 Most in one day: 20mm/0.78" (7th) --------------------- Sunshine hours: 175.5** Most in one day: 15.5*** Sunless days: 1 --------------------- Average Pressure: 1018mb/30.06" Highest: 1030mb/30.41" (23rd) Lowest: 1003mb/29.62" (7th) --------------------- Days with Sleet/Snow: 0 Days with Hail/Ice Pellets:0 Days with Thunder heard: 2 (7th, 15th) Days with Fog: NA *Based on estimate. Could be higher than actual **Incomplete (28 days worth of data) *** Estimate After just two warm days an notable cold and unsettled period set in, with the 7th in particular having terrible weather; persistent and heavy rain in the day with a temperature of just 8.6c at 3pm. Cool and changeable continued for the next few days. A return to average or above average temperatures by 12th, followed by a day of heavy showers, rain and storms on 15th. Very easterly mostly settled second half. A warmish spell at the end of the month. The month yet again saw below average sunshine. Overall the temperature was slightly above average. Pretty poor for thunder with no direct thunderstorms just a couple of rumbles each time.
